Helen Mirren prefers charity shop outfits to taking luggage
Helen Mirren has revealed that she hates carrying mountains of luggage from place to place so just buys new clothes whenever she arrives at a new destination - but she doesn’t like to spend a lot of money to do it.
She told Good Housekeeping magazine recently: “If I travel anywhere particularly cold or hot, I don’t take any clothes with me. At the airport I’ll ask the taxi driver to take me to the nearest charity shop where I’ll buy what I need for the trip.”
“When it’s time to come home, I take them back to the shop. That way I don’t have to haul luggage around with me and I get the pleasure of wearing a new outfit for only 50p!”
“Even though I’m now in a position to go shopping, I don’t indulge very often - it’s just not in my nature. I might buy a designer top but only if it’s discounted by 80 per cent. A 50 per cent reduction just isn’t enough.”
